The container problem

Nexseal LE closed-cell — the only insulation that truly bonds to corrugated steel

A shipping container is single-skin corrugated steel with no insulation — a condensation factory. Nexseal LE closed-cell spray foam bonds directly to the corrugated walls, roof and doors of an ISO container, creating a seamless thermal barrier, vapour control layer and anti-condensation coating in a single application. At λ 0.027 W/m·K it delivers maximum thermal performance at minimal thickness — critical where every millimetre of internal space matters.

  • Bonds directly to corrugated steel — no priming, no fixings, follows every ridge and trough
  • Integral vapour barrier — eliminates condensation at the steel face
  • 15–25mm anti-condensation coat or 35–50mm+ for full conversions

Two routes

Anti-condensation coat vs full container conversion

The right specification depends entirely on how the container is used. Storage containers need a thin anti-condensation coat. Container conversions need thicker insulation with stud framing for a plasterboard-ready finish.

Thin anti-condensation spray foam coat on the ceiling of a storage shipping container
15–25mm · direct to steel

Anti-condensation coat

A thin layer of Nexseal LE sprayed directly onto bare corrugated steel. Raises the surface above dew point and completely eliminates container rain. The corrugated profile stays visible. Ideal for storage, self-storage units and container yards.

  • No studs — sprayed straight to the steel
  • Minimal internal space impact
  • Half a day to a day per container

Full conversion insulation with spray foam between timber studs in a shipping container
35–50mm+ · between studs

Full conversion insulation

Timber studs fixed to the container walls, with Nexseal LE sprayed between and over them for a continuous thermal envelope. Creates a flat, plasterboard-ready surface for offices, workshops, studios and pop-up retail.

  • Continuous envelope with zero thermal bridging
  • Flat, plasterboard-ready finish
  • 2–3 days depending on scope

Container rain

Why shipping containers get condensation

Single-skin corrugated steel with no insulation is a condensation factory. Here is how closed-cell spray foam solves every aspect of the problem.

Container rain

Warm moist air meets the cold steel roof and walls, forming droplets that drip onto stored goods. Causes mould, corrosion, packaging damage and stock write-offs.

Temperature swings

Steel containers heat up rapidly in sun and cool fast overnight. These daily swings are the primary driver of condensation — especially in Ireland’s damp maritime climate.

Spray foam solution

Closed-cell foam raises the internal surface above dew point and acts as an integral vapour barrier. No cold surface means no condensation — a permanent fix, not a temporary measure.

Self-storage protection

Storage container businesses suffer most from condensation complaints — customers’ furniture, documents and electronics get damaged. Spray foam eliminates the problem across entire container fleets.

Corrugation coverage

Unlike rigid board or foil-bubble insulation, spray foam follows every ridge and trough of the corrugated steel. No air gaps means no hidden condensation forming behind the insulation.

Why do shipping containers get condensation inside?
Shipping containers are made from single-skin corrugated steel with no insulation. When warm moist air inside the container meets the cold steel walls and roof, moisture condenses on the surface — a phenomenon known as container rain. This is especially severe in the Irish climate where day-to-night temperature swings are common. The corrugated profile channels condensation into drips that soak stored goods, cause corrosion and promote mould growth.
How does spray foam stop container rain and condensation?
Closed-cell spray foam bonds directly to the corrugated steel walls and roof of the container, raising the internal surface temperature above the dew point. Because the foam acts as both insulation and an integral vapour barrier, there is no cold steel surface for moisture to condense on. Even a thin 15–25mm coat of Nexseal LE eliminates container rain completely.
What thickness of spray foam does a shipping container need?
It depends on the intended use. For anti-condensation protection in storage containers, 15–25mm of closed-cell Nexseal LE sprayed directly to the steel is sufficient. For full container conversions — offices, workshops, studios — a thicker application of 35–50mm+ between timber studs is typically used to meet thermal performance requirements for year-round comfort and TGD L (Technical Booklet F2 in Northern Ireland) where applicable.
Can spray foam be applied directly to corrugated steel?
Yes. Closed-cell spray foam has excellent adhesion to steel. It bonds directly to the corrugated profile of shipping container walls, roof and doors without any preparation other than ensuring the surface is clean and dry. The foam follows every ridge and trough of the corrugation, creating a continuous thermal barrier with zero gaps.
Is spray foam suitable for container storage businesses?
Absolutely. Self-storage operators, container yard businesses and portable storage providers are among the most common users of anti-condensation spray foam. A thin coat of Nexseal LE protects customers’ belongings from condensation damage, mould and corrosion — reducing complaints, insurance claims and unit refurbishment costs. The investment pays for itself quickly through fewer damage claims and higher customer satisfaction.
How long does it take to insulate a shipping container?
A standard 20ft or 40ft container can typically be spray-foamed in a single day for anti-condensation work. Container conversions with timber studwork take 2–3 days depending on the scope. The foam itself cures in minutes, so there is no drying time. Multiple containers on the same site can be completed in quick succession.
What is the difference between anti-condensation and full conversion insulation?
Anti-condensation spray is a thin coat (15–25mm) of closed-cell foam applied directly to the bare steel to stop condensation and container rain. The corrugated profile remains visible. Full conversion insulation uses timber studs fixed to the container walls, with thicker spray foam (35–50mm+) applied between and over the studs. This creates a flat, plasterboard-ready surface and delivers the thermal performance needed for heated, occupied spaces like offices and workshops.

Can a shipping container meet Building Regulations after spray foam insulation?
Yes, where the container is being converted for occupied use. A full conversion with 35–50mm+ of Nexseal LE between timber studs across the walls, roof and floor can achieve the thermal performance needed to satisfy TGD L, with zero thermal bridging around the framing. We provide U-value calculations and documentation for building control on conversion projects.
Can containers be insulated in situ on my site?
Yes. Containers do not need to be moved — they can be sprayed in situ on your site. The container interior must be empty and the doors accessible. For multi-level stacks, individual containers can be sprayed before stacking. This makes it easy to treat an entire container fleet with minimal disruption.
Does spray foam insulation come with a warranty?
Yes. Enverge Nexseal LE closed-cell foam carries a 25-year manufacturer-backed material warranty against material defects. The installation is covered by a workmanship warranty from the approved installer who carries out the work. Full warranty documentation is included in your completion pack.
